A practical first step is organizing a clear timeline, noting who was involved, what was observed, and what communications occurred. Early, careful documentation can support later decision-making without presuming fault before the facts are reviewed.
Legal guidance often centers on whether the situation aligns with recognized standards of care and whether there is a provable connection between actions or omissions and the resident's outcome.
